Jerry Kuehn introduced Broadway Tennis Center owners Anne and  Horacio Matta. They are parents of three boys. Anne fell in love with tennis at Age 9.  After college at the University of Texas, Anne turned pro and was ranked in the Top 100 in the world, competing at Wimbledon, The French Open, The Australian Open, and The U.S. Open. Horacio was born in Santiago, Chile, and was a two-time college national champion with Universidad Catolica de Chile.  Horacio turned pro at 19 and competed internationally for four years.
 
Ann shared that where the Broadway Tennis Center stands today was a large parking lot when they came upon it.  They envisioned a public, indoor tennis facility. Built in eleven months, the Tennis Center has been  in operation for 16 months.  In addition to tennis lessons, varied events are  held at the Center.  The height of the cavernous space is of regulation dimensions.  The flooring is Deco-Turf as used by the U.S. Open.
 
Horacio shared that he learned to play tennis and inherited his love of tennis from his father who is now 80.  His dad claims that he is now too old, too fat, and too tired to play tennis;  still, he just picked up his racquet again and is enjoying tennis once again.
Lots of young people are lured by the possibility of professional tennis careers to the extent that they will often elect to put off university educations.  Anne and Horacio specifically encourage that degrees be pursued.  There are areas for kids to do their homework upstairs, to help kids be properly directed and supported.
